What is a Behavioral Health Consultant?

A Behavioral Health Consultant (BHC) is a healthcare professional who assists individuals in addressing mental health issues in various settings. Their role primarily revolves around providing behavioral health support within primary care practices, hospitals, and community health centers. BHCs assist in diagnosing, treating, and managing mental health conditions such as depression, anxiety, and substance use disorders.

Key Responsibilities of Behavioral Health Consultants

Before getting into the specific duties, it’s essential to understand the core responsibilities that Behavioral Health Consultants undertake to improve patient care and well-being.

Assessing Patients’ Needs

Behavioral Health Consultants conduct brief assessments to evaluate patients’ psychological states. They observe behavioral patterns, listen to concerns, and identify any mental health issues that may require intervention. These assessments allow them to recommend appropriate care or refer patients to specialists if needed.

Providing Immediate Behavioral Support

One of the main tasks of Behavioral Health Consultants is to offer immediate support for mental health concerns. They provide short-term interventions for patients experiencing anxiety, stress, or other behavioral challenges. BHCs also guide patients in developing coping strategies, practicing mindfulness exercises, and utilizing techniques to enhance emotional well-being.

Collaborating with Healthcare Teams

Behavioral Health Consultants work closely with primary care physicians and other healthcare providers to develop treatment plans. This collaboration ensures that patients receive holistic care, addressing both their physical and psychological needs. By integrating behavioral health into primary care, BHCs help reduce the stigma around mental health issues.

Educating Patients and Staff

Part of a BHC’s role is to educate both patients and healthcare staff about behavioral health. They raise awareness about various mental health conditions, prevention strategies, and the importance of seeking help. Their educational efforts empower patients to take charge of their mental health and encourage a more empathetic approach from healthcare professionals.

Work Settings for Behavioral Health Consultants

Behavioral Health Consultants typically work in a variety of healthcare settings. These include primary care clinics, hospitals, behavioral health centers, and community health organizations. Their presence in primary care environments has grown, as more healthcare providers recognize the importance of addressing mental health issues early and effectively.

Qualifications and Training

To become a Behavioral Health Consultant, professionals typically need a Master’s degree in psychology, social work, or a related field. They must also have relevant certifications and licensure, which vary by region. Continuous education and training are crucial for staying current with new treatment methods and advancements in mental health research.
